The metrics-aggregation sidecar (codename Gaugelet) ships as a signed container image alongside every service pod in the Ostrand cluster. It batches counters locally and flushes to the aggregator every 15 seconds; if flushes stall, check the sidecar logs before restarting the pod, since a restart drops the in-memory batch. On-call engineers redeploying the sidecar must pull the image through the verified channel — unsigned images are rejected at admission. Verification during manual redeploys requires the current signing key, listed below.

rollout seal: bky4_DFM9

### Step 4: Load-test the checkout flow

Before you publish your plugin for Cartwheel's new checkout pipeline, run the bundled load harness against the sandbox tier. Keep concurrency modest at first — the sandbox throttles aggressively and you'll just get noise. Your plugin must survive the standard ten-minute ramp without dropped sessions. Run the harness with the following configuration.

deployment values, kaweg-yahap:
OLIAEL_PIN=6327
OLIAEL_METRICS_HOST=metrics.oliael.paliqworks.internal
OLIAEL_LOG_LEVEL=error
OLIAEL_TENANT=caseth

Q: The Fernlock retention sweeper stopped mid-run — what now? A: Check the sweeper's cursor table first; a stale cursor means the previous run died holding a lock. Clear it, restart the worker, and confirm deletions resume within ten minutes. Never skip the dry-run flag on legal-hold tenants. To reopen the sweeper's sealed admin shell, enter the recovery passphrase below.

recovery phrase for fafof-kagaf: eliath-zormir

Handover: Quartzline Query Planner Regression

To the release manager — the v4.2 planner picks nested-loop joins on the billing tables, regressing nightly reports by 6x. I've pinned the old planner via feature flag and documented repro steps in the runbook. To toggle the flag in production you'll need the override vault, which opens with the recovery passphrase below.

unlock words, fafop-hawep: briwyn-oliix-sorox

**Vendor note: Inkmill markdown pipeline**

Rendering for Parchway docs is outsourced to Inkmill under an annual contract, renewing each March. They handle sanitization and PDF export; we own the upload queue. SLA: 4-hour response on rendering failures. Escalate only after two failed retries. Their support desk is reachable at the address below.

billing contact of hahaf-baguf = zorael.tammir.jorius@sivrelhq.internal